WATCH: Russia’s synchronized swimmers produce mesmerizing routine to win World Championship gold ...News

Russia Today - News
WATCH: Russia’s synchronized swimmers produce mesmerizing routine to win World Championship gold
Russia's synchronized swimmers continued their dominance at the World Championships in South Korea as the women’s team won gold in the Technical final. Read Full Article at RT.com

Read More Details
Finally We wish PressBee provided you with enough information of ( WATCH: Russia’s synchronized swimmers produce mesmerizing routine to win World Championship gold )

Apple Storegoogle play

Also on site :